How to sew a kitten from a sock with your own hands?

How to sew a kitten from a sock with your own hands? - briefly

To create a kitten from a sock, you will need a sock, stuffing, thread, scissors, and basic sewing skills. Begin by cutting the sock to the desired shape and size of the kitten, then sew and stuff the body, head, and limbs before adding final details.

To craft a sock kitten, follow these steps:

  1. Gather materials: a sock, stuffing, thread, scissors, and a needle.

  2. Determine the size and shape of the kitten and cut the sock accordingly.

  3. Begin by sewing the body. Fill it with stuffing, ensuring it is firm but pliable.

  4. Create the head by cutting and sewing a smaller piece of the sock, then stuff it similarly.

  5. Form the limbs by sewing and stuffing four small pieces, attaching them to the body.

  6. Add details such as eyes and a nose using fabric markers or small pieces of felt.

  7. Finally, stitch any remaining openings and add finishing touches to give the kitten a lifelike appearance.

How to sew a kitten from a sock with your own hands? - in detail

Creating a kitten from a sock is a delightful and straightforward craft project that allows for creativity and personalization. This guide will walk you through the process step-by-step, ensuring you have all the necessary information to complete this charming project.

First, gather your materials. You will need a sock, preferably one with a colorful or patterned design to add character to your kitten. Additionally, you will require stuffing material, such as polyester fiberfill, to give your kitten its shape. Scissors, a needle, and thread are essential for cutting and sewing. Fabric markers or paint can be used to add details like eyes and a nose. Optional materials include buttons, ribbons, and other embellishments to make your kitten unique.

Begin by cutting the sock to the desired size and shape of your kitten. Typically, you will cut the sock just below the heel and ankle area, leaving the toe part for the kitten's head. The remaining part of the sock can be used for the body. Ensure that the cut is clean and even to facilitate easy sewing.

Next, sew the bottom of the sock closed to create the base of the kitten's body. Use a simple running stitch or a whipstitch to secure the opening. Make sure the stitches are tight and secure to prevent the stuffing from falling out later. This step is crucial for the structural integrity of your kitten.

Now, stuff the sock with the fiberfill. Start by adding a small amount of stuffing to the toe part, which will form the head. Gradually add more stuffing to the body, ensuring it is evenly distributed. Be careful not to overstuff, as this can make the kitten look misshapen. The goal is to achieve a plump and round appearance.

Once the kitten is stuffed to your satisfaction, sew the top of the sock closed. Again, use a running stitch or whipstitch to secure the opening. This will complete the basic shape of your kitten. Ensure the stitches are tight and the stuffing is securely contained.

To add facial features, use fabric markers or paint to draw eyes and a nose. You can also use small buttons or beads for a more three-dimensional effect. Be creative with the placement and size of these features to give your kitten a unique personality. If desired, you can also add a mouth by stitching or drawing a small curve below the nose.

For additional details, consider adding ears, a tail, or other embellishments. Ears can be made from small pieces of felt or fabric, sewn onto the top of the head. A tail can be created from a strip of fabric, sewn to the back of the kitten. Ribbons, bows, and other decorations can be added to enhance the kitten's charm.

Finally, give your kitten a good press to ensure all the stuffing is evenly distributed and the seams are smooth. Your handmade kitten is now complete and ready to be displayed or given as a gift.
